Roberson runners fare well at adidas meet

Cary, N.C. — Second place is becoming something of a theme for Roberson junior Brooke Gordon.

For the third consecutive meet, Gordon finished in second place, this time at the adidas Cross Country Challenge in Cary. Gordon finished behind Durham Academy’s Elize Dekker (17:58.2), crossing the finish line in 18:14.8, improving on her season’s best of  18:38.85.

Roberson's Rachel Koon recorded the third-fastest time in WNC this season over 5k. Photo Credit: Erin Brethauer/Asheville Citizen-Times

Other Roberson finishers included: Rachel Koon (30th, 19:49.3), Anastasia Soule (32nd, 19:53.6), Elizabeth Mosher (34th, 19:55.4), Casey Greenwalt (38th, 20:19.5), Ella Bozeman (49th, 20:38.9),  Ashley Mull (66th, 21:12.5), Lauren Cook (70th, 21:16.9), Megan McDonald (95th, 21:58.0).

In the team standings, the Roberson girls finished  in fifth behind first-place Midlothian, Henderson, Broughton, and Cardinal Gibbons.

On the boy’s side, Roberson senior Robert Kovach turned in the second fastest time in WNC this season over 5k (29th, 16:24) to lead the Rams to a seventh-place finish in the team standings.

Other Roberson finishers included: Alex Zorich (52nd, 16:51.4), Zach Houser (68th, 17:10.9), River Gordon (74th, 17:15.9), John Larson (84th, 17:24.9), Chris Harpe (95th, 17:32.9),  Charles Harpe (129th, 17:58.4), Jesse Kovacs (135th,18:05), Noah McMurry (167th, 18:35.9).
